street food festival gather with your foodie friends to feast on street food specialties created by over 20 inventive chefs from across the state. head down to the river plaza by the uss kidd for all day eats, drinks, and live music in celebration of
louisiana
street food culture and community on saturday, january 13 from 11 a.m.-5 p.m. the lost bayou ramblers will play from 1-3 p.m. open to all with no cover charge. ?
